Bill Davis was a football coach in the National Football League (NFL) from 1992 to 2022, finishing his career as the linebackers coach of the Arizona Cardinals. Over his twenty-eight years of coaching his teams compiled a cumulative win/loss record of 207-241-2. Davis will be the new linebackers coach for the Houston Texans for the 2024 season.

Bill Davis, a veteran assistant coach in the National Football League who has seven years of experience as a defensive coordinator in the NFL, is in his first season as linebackers coach at Ohio State University. Davis joined the staff in December 2016.

Billy Davis (born November 5, 1965 in Youngstown, Ohio) is an American football coach in the NFL for the Cleveland Browns. He is the linebackers coach. He previously served as the defensive coordinator for the Arizona Cardinals. He was the defensive coordinator for the San Francisco 49ers from 2005 through 2006.
